This contemplative devotional episode centers on Matthew 12:15–21 in the New Living Translation (NLT). Matthew connects Jesus’ healing ministry and withdrawal from conflict with Isaiah’s prophecy of the Servant who will not crush the weakest reed or put out a flickering candle, but will bring justice to victory.

In Mark 3:7–12 (NLT), huge crowds press in around Jesus to be healed, and even demons fall down and cry out, “You are the Son of God!” Jesus moves through the chaos with calm authority, caring for the sick and silencing evil spirits.
